老师介绍
赵珊珊

简介:曾就职于北京立思辰有限公司担任Java高级工程师岗位,一线开发经验,国税地税税务系统专家,内训专家讲师。 拥有8年一线教学经验,培养学员10w+,人美声甜会讲课,讲课细致清晰。

课程介绍

课程白皮书

课程介绍和目标

大家好,我是这门课程的讲师赵珊珊。相信越来越多的小伙伴跻身于Java行业了,有的人是爱好Java,有的人经历苦苦自学,有的人想要转行,有的人想要进大厂,各怀壮志,那么其中必经的一关就是Java基础。本阶段小课是程序员入门的门槛,很多初学者也常忽略基础的重要性,认为学习的重头戏在框架等方面,但其实基础才是重中之重。本阶段小课重点讲解JavaSE初阶段技能点,算是JavaSE的基础,帮同学们打好基础,细致入微讲解,面面俱到,增加学习兴趣,我们需要学习:初识Java、数据类型、运算符、流程控制、方法、数组。如果你之前有其它语言基础的话,你会发现各个语言基础语法其实差异化很小,Java也是比较好入门的一种语言。在学习的同时,要感受老师的逻辑思路,学习老师的编程写作方法,掌握最基本的语法结构。

编译执行过程

编译执行过程.png

数据类型分类

数据类型.png

常用运算符

运算符.png

控制流程结构

控制流程结构.png

价值与收获

获取JavaSE初级技能点:

​ 了解Java简史、学会使用API

​ 掌握编译、执行原理,了解虚拟机原理

​ 精通数据类型、运算符、流程控制

​ 精通方法的定义/调用/重载

​ 掌握数组的使用

适合人群

1.对Java感兴趣的同学

2.零基础转行的同学

3.本专业计算机同学

4.工作、学习中对Java有需求的同学

课程指导

本套课程案例结合理论,深入细致讲解,让学生更加生动清晰的理解技能点。案例结合笔记,笔记详尽细致,学生无需自行记录笔记,可在老师基础上做优化、补充即可,提高学习效率。初学者一定要记住一个非常好的学习方法,即“囫囵吞枣”,不要焦虑恐慌,经常听到初学者说自己“听得懂,不会自己敲”,其实这是非常正常的现象,因为代码量没有达标,随着代码量的积累,一定会将技能点融会贯通,所以切勿焦虑,耐心持续学习即可。

JavaSE初级笔记内容.png

课程内容

第一章:JAVA初步
    1.计算机语言的发展历史
    2.JAVA简史
    3.JAVA体系结构
    4.JAVA特性和优势
    5.JAVA核心机制之垃圾收集机制
    6.核心机制之 JAVA跨平台原理
    7.JAVA核心机制之对比C语言的跨平台原理
    8.JAVA常用的DOS命令
    9.JDK的下载_安装 _卸载
    10.notepad++的安装
    11.第一段程序_ 编译 _执行
    12.程序中常见错误
    13.编译方式
    14.扩展 classpath环境变量
    15.扩展  JAVA_HOME 环境变量
    16.API
    17.代码量统计工具的使用
    18.单行注释和多行注释
    19.文档注释
    20.反编译工具的使用
    21.本章最后一段代码
    22.扩展面试题 JDK,JRE
第二章:数据类型
    1.标识符
    2.关键字
    3.常量_字面常量
    4.变量的声明,赋值,使用 
    5.变量的内存
    6.变量的作用域
    7.基本数据类型之整数类型常量 
    8.基本数据类型之整数类型变量
    9.基本数据类型之浮点类型常量的两种形式
    10.基本数据类型之浮点类型变量
    11.编码和字符集
    12.基本数据类型之字符类型1
    13.基本数据类型之字符类型2
    14.解释乱码问题
    15.基本数据类型之布尔类型
    16.基本数据类型转换问题
    17.习题final_字符常量
    18.习题 _ 加深对Scanner的使用
第三章: 运算符
    1.JAVA中的运算符概述
    2.算数运算符_除法 _取余
    3.算数运算符_加号
    4.算数运算符 _自增
    5.赋值运算符
    6.扩展数值运算符
    7.关系运算符
    8.逻辑运算符
    9.三元运算符
    10.位运算符
    11.运算符_总结
    12.运算符的优先级别
第四章:流程控制
    1.引入
    2.分支结构_if单分支
    3.分支结构_if多分支
    4.分支结构_if双分支
    5.随机数
    6.分支的嵌套使用_练习1
    7.分支的嵌套使用_练习2
    8.分支结构_switch分支
    9.循环结构_while循环
    10.循环结构_while循环练习
    11.循环结构_do-while循环
    12.循环结构_for循环
    13.循环结构_关键字break
    14.循环结构_关键字continue
    15.循环结构_关键字return
    16.循环结构_循环练习1
    17.循环结构_循环练习2
    18.循环结构_循环嵌套 _乘法口诀
    19.循环结构-循环嵌套1
    20.循环结构_循环嵌套2
    21.循环结构_循环嵌套
第五章:方法的定义,调用,重载
    1.方法的定义和调用
    2.方法提取的练习
    3.面试题 _两个数交换是否成功
    4.方法的重载
第六章:数组
    1.数组的引用
    2.数组的学习
    3.数组习题完善_数组的遍历方式
    4.数组的三种初始化方式
    5.数组的应用_最值问题
    6.数组的应用_查询问题
    7.数组的应用_添加元素
    8.数组的应用_删除元素
    9.详述main方法
    10.可变参数
    11.Arrays工具类的使用
    12.数组的复制
    13.二维数组的定义和遍历
    14.二维数组的初始化方式
课程章节
章节1:马士兵教育发展史 (1节)

课时01

马士兵教育发展史

免费试学

21分10秒

章节2:初识Java (6节)

课时02

计算机语言的发展历史

更新时间:2025-03-24

13分29秒

课时03

Java语言的发展简史

更新时间:2025-03-24

4分52秒

课时04

Java能做什么&Java体系结构

更新时间:2025-03-24

免费试学

4分48秒

课时05

Java的核心机制介绍-垃圾收集机制

更新时间:2025-03-24

免费试学

5分5秒

课时06

Java的核心机制介绍-跨平台原理

更新时间:2025-03-24

免费试学

9分23秒

课时07

本章回顾

更新时间:2025-03-24

免费试学

4分53秒

章节3:入门探素 (11节)

课时08

常用DOS命令

更新时间:2025-03-24

免费试学

12分22秒

课时09

JDK的下载和安装

更新时间:2025-03-24

免费试学

4分54秒

课时10

第一个Java程序

更新时间:2025-03-24

免费试学

8分14秒

课时11

程序中常见问题

更新时间:2025-03-24

免费试学

7分53秒

课时12

代码量统计工具的便用

更新时间:2025-03-24

免费试学

2分30秒

课时13

APl

更新时间:2025-03-24

免费试学

4分26秒

课时14

注释-单行注释&多行注释

更新时间:2025-03-24

免费试学

13分18秒

课时15

注释-支档注释

更新时间:2025-03-24

免费试学

11分6秒

课时16

反编译工具的使用

更新时间:2025-03-24

免费试学

4分17秒

课时17

第二个Java程序

更新时间:2025-03-24

免费试学

15分41秒

课时18

本章回顾

更新时间:2025-03-24

免费试学

6分28秒

章节4:开发工具 (8节)

课时19

IDEA的介绍

更新时间:2025-03-24

10分33秒

课时20

IDEA的下载和安装

更新时间:2025-03-24

免费试学

5分47秒

课时21

HelloWorld的编写

更新时间:2025-03-24

免费试学

9分50秒

课时22

IDEA窗口各导航展示

更新时间:2025-03-24

免费试学

4分23秒

课时23

Module的概念和使用

更新时间:2025-03-24

免费试学

7分2秒

课时24

IDEA的常用设置

更新时间:2025-03-24

免费试学

12分23秒

课时25

IDEA的常用快捷键

更新时间:2025-03-24

免费试学

11分22秒

课时26

本章回顾

更新时间:2025-03-24

免费试学

2分4秒

章节5:基础概念 (0节)
章节6:数据类型之基本数据类型 (0节)
章节7:运算符 (0节)
章节8:流程控制 (0节)
章节9:方法 (0节)
章节10:数组 (0节)
章节11:综合案例双色球彩票系统) (0节)
0个问题,0回答
提问
暂无提问,赶紧去提问吧~